
My Story
I've always been career driven. I grew up on a small farm in Washington State where at the age of 15, I started volunteering at the local community hospital. Before I even graduated high school I was hired as an Emergency Room Admitting clerk. Through that position, I developed a unique emotional intelligence and empathy which I carry with me today.
I moved away to the big city of Seattle, attended University and started my career in Project Management, after a few years I realized I wanted to explore other opportunities. During this time Myspace was alive and kicking, Facebook was entering its adolescent stage and Twitter was the new kid on the block. I was fascinated and decided to steer my career down this new social media path. I dubbed myself the Social Scientist and started helping companies launch all these fun new communications channels.
All of this brought me to Microsoft, where I was able to find and explore a new way to use these social media platforms. We responded and engaged with customers – starting small with one product, Office 365. We quickly grew adding product after product. In less than 2 years, we built the Microsoft Customer Experience Center and expanded to over 15 products and 35+ people.
This is when an opportunity to join McDonald's as a global head came my way. I was ready for this challenge and quickly launched McDonald's Global Brand Hub which spanned three locations Chicago, London, and Singapore.
I realized at an early age that I enjoy building and innovating. That's why in 2017 I decided to build a team that helps create similar operations for a number of brands. I not only enjoy connecting with people, but I enjoy helping companies connect with their customers through impactful human-centered experiences.
